Fracture TechnologiesSummarySummary
• The intention of this project is to assess the The intention of this project is to assess the effectiveness of matching the post Frac test effectiveness of matching the post Frac test data, in order to match a Beta for the data, in order to match a Beta for the proppant size utilised in the fracproppant size utilised in the frac
• A total of six wells have been matched, out of A total of six wells have been matched, out of which three are presented herewhich three are presented here
• Three examples are presented for the Three examples are presented for the following proppant sizes.following proppant sizes.• 20/40 single phase20/40 single phase• 16/20 multi-phase (oil and gas)16/20 multi-phase (oil and gas)• 12/18 single phase12/18 single phase

Fracture TechnologiesSummary of Field BetaSummary of Field Beta
ProppSize
ProppConc(Lb/ft2)
Perm
(D)
Beta(S.Ph)(1/ft)
n1 n2
20/40 4.0 150 50,000 ---- -----
16/20 3.0 270 30,200 0.50 5.50
12/18 2.0 400 5,000 ----- -----
